day one new delhi: endangered species

The man next to me on the plane was trying to sleep, contorting his body into about every position it was possible to make with the number of limbs he had to work with. I was annoying him by having my light on.

I can't really sleep on planes. I passed the time watching The Poseidon Adventure because you really want to see disaster movies when you're thousands of feet up in the air. And then I subjected myself to a breathtakingly repellent comedy called Bride Wars which you'd only watch all the way through if you were in solitary confinement. There you go then.
